How much does it cost to drive from Bromley to Kettering with petrol?

Let's delve into the expenses of a road trip from Bromley to Kettering. The journey using petrol will set you back 20.3 pounds. Now, let's walk through how we arrived at this figure.

Firstly, we consider the price of petrol, which is 144 pence per liter. Next, we take into account the car's fuel consumption rate, which stands at 37.5 miles per gallon.

Now, suppose you're carpooling. If there are two passengers sharing the ride, each person will contribute 10.15 pounds (£20.3 divided by 2). With three passengers, the cost per person drops to around 6.77 pounds (£20.3 divided by 3). And if there are four passengers onboard, each person chips in 5.08 pounds (£20.3 divided by 4).

Let's delve deeper into the calculations. To determine how much fuel is needed for the trip, we rely on the distance and the car's fuel efficiency. The distance between Bromley and Kettering is approximately 116.26 miles. So, to cover this distance, the car will require roughly 14.1 liters of petrol. We obtained this value by dividing the distance by the car's fuel consumption rate of 37.5 miles per gallon and then converting it to liters.

Once we have the amount of fuel needed, we calculate the total cost. Multiplying the fuel quantity (14.1 liters) by the price per liter (144 pence) yields 20.3 pounds. Therefore, the fuel cost for the journey from Bromley to Kettering is 20.3 pounds.
